PULVERIZED COAL CONCENTRATION REGULATING MECHANISM FOR COAL PULVERIZER

PURPOSE:To permit the securing of the speed and amount of airflow without deteriorating a pulverized coal concentration by providing a circulating passageway for circulating air containing pulverized coal. CONSTITUTION:The rough particles of coal are separated from pulverized coal in the hopper 29 of a classifier by utilizing the centrifugal force of eddy current whereby air containing the rough particles of coal, air containing the pulverized coal and air diluted in the concentration of the pulverized coal, are present in a sequence from the outside of the eddy. The air diluted in the concentration of the pulverized coal is sucked into a bent tube 40 and circulates through a circulating passageway 41, then, blown up through the slits 42 of a throat 23 to blow up the pulverized coal together with usual primary air. In this case, the flow amount of the primary air, supplied from a primary air duct 12, the amount of coal, supplied by a coal supply tube 4, and the flow amount of air, circulating through the circulating passageway 41, can be measured respectively. The ventilating amount of a re-circulating fan 44 is controlled in accordance with the results of these measurements, whereby the concentration of the pulverized coal of a coal pulverizer 5 may be regulated freely. According to this method, the flow speed and the flow amount of the primary air in the throat 23 may be secured and the concentration of the pulverized coal may be increased simultaneously.
